Among the most popular dishes, youâll find Mofongo, Pernil, and Sancocho, all of which showcase the heart and soul of Dominican cooking. Mofongo, a dish made from fried green plantains, is often served with a flavorful garlic sauce and your choice of meat. Pernil, or roasted pork shoulder, is another signature dish that tantalizes the taste buds with its crispy skin and tender meat. Additionally, the comforting Rice and Beans, savory Empanadas, and hearty Oxtail are staples that highlight the depth of flavors present in Dominican food in Bronx.
